Youthfest 2011 results

After a very entertaining day, here are the results of Youthfest 2011: The Ann Hill Award For Best Senior Production "The Cage Birds" Expression Drama Studio The Jack and Mavis Hart Award Foe Best Junior Production "Little Red Whittington" East Waikiki Primary School The Melville Theatre Encouragement Award Sawyer's Valley Primary School, for encouraging participation in all aspects of theatre Best Actor (Senior Section) Noah Watkins, "The Seussification of Romeo and Juliet", Helena College Best Actress (Senior Section) Julia Jardine, "The Cage Birds", Expression Drama Studio Best Actor (Junior Section) Blake Caldwell, "Little Red Whittington", East Waikiki Primary School Best Actress (Junior Section) Maeve Sheen, "Gobbledegook", Kidact Most Innovative Production Sawyer's Valley Primary School, "One Good Turn", for innovative costuming Best Stage Manager Damon Whitfield, Sawyer's Valley Primary School Adjudicator's Certificates: Costuming - "The Seussification of Romeo and Juliet", Helena College Ensemble Acting - "The Cage Birds", Expression Drama Studio Characterisation - Anthony Stampalita, "Little Red Whittington", East Waikiki Primary School Characterisation - Kate Hooper, "A Night Without TV, Music and Gossiping", Kidact Characterisation - Jolyon Joyce, "One Good Turn", Sawyer's Valley Primary School Characterisation - Lachlan Kessey, "Disney's Aladdin Kids", Sawyer's Valley Primary School Animation - Jessica Hill, "Gobbledegook", Kidact A very big thank you to our hosts, Roleystone Theatre, and our adjudicator, Kerri Hilton.
